Smoky BBQ Pork Sandwiches

  • Prep: 30 mins
  • Cook: 9 hr.
  • Ready in: 9 hr., 30 mins
  • Serves:

Ingredients

  • 4 Tbl. spoon Brown sugar
  • 2 tsp Garlic minced
  • 4 tsp McCormick chili powder
  • 1 tsp Ground coriander
  • 1/2 tbl spoon Pure ground black pepper
  • 1/2 tbl. spoon McCormick ground cayenne red pepper
  • 1 5 lb. Boneless pork shoulder roast fat trimmed cut into 1" pieces
  • 2 med Yellow onions thinly sliced
  • 2 cups Honey Brown larger beer
  • 2 cups Smokey Mesquite Bar-B-Q Sauce
  • 8-10 Onion rolls
  • 8-10 slices Gouda cheese (optional)

Cooking Instructions

1. In a small bowl combine brown sugar garlic chili powder coriander pepper and cayenne pepper mix well. 2. Place pork and seasonings into slow cooker; stir to mix well. Add onions and pour in beer; make sure onions are submerged in liquid. 3. Cover and cook on high 7-8 hours or until meat shreds easily. 4. Remove pork and onions with slotted spoon and place on cutting board; shred pork with 2 forks. 5. Remove and discard all but 2 cups of liquid remaining in slow cooker. Add pork and onions back to slow cooker; stir in barbeque sauce. Cover and cook on high 30 minutes. 6. Serve on onion rolls with cheese if desired.

Recipe Notes

Serve with a good creamy coleslaw
